Transaction 2885f3f6cf6840072053f018edee30e37f220bd8b8e8ea3d39cea0ff2960782d

1 Input
2 Outputs
  • 2885f3f6cf6840072053f018edee30e37f220bd8b8e8ea3d39cea0ff2960782d:0
  • value  51330411
    address  16eMfzeQVpfaK8fxECEeKjyS64p2BLExVv
  • 2885f3f6cf6840072053f018edee30e37f220bd8b8e8ea3d39cea0ff2960782d:1
  • value  2748146
    address  1FnqTxnmtLNxf8JQW4E164dfxf1in6Jq6u